This is an exciting career opportunity to work as an Assistant in Nursing (AIN) as part of our dynamic nursing team at Northern Beaches Hospital.
Ward 6D is an adult general medical ward with 30 beds. Of these 20 are double rooms with ensuites and ten are single rooms which include one negative pressure room and one bariatric room with a ceiling hoist. We provide dedicated care for medical patients specialising in geriatric care for elderly frail individuals and those with cognitive impairments.

About Northern Beaches Hospital
Northern Beaches Hospital provides worldclass Level 5 delineation services for both public and private patients. The hospital features 486 beds a 50bed Emergency Department a 20bed general and cardiothoracic ICU 14 stateoftheart theatres including cardiac catheter labs a worldclass education centre a doctors lounge and excellent staff facilities including acaf and car parking.
From cardiothoracic surgery and neurosurgery to luxury maternity and excellent emergency care Northern Beaches Hospital has a wide range of services that can help you build a healthcare career in your chosen field.
We are proud to be home to some of Australias leading clinical specialists and a training ground for the clinicians of the future. The Northern Beaches Clinical School is an innovative partnership with the Faculty of Medicine Health and Human Sciences at Macquarie University. NBH also has partnerships with other tertiary education institutions including wellrespected nursing schools.
Northern Beaches Hospital offers staff opportunities to gain unique experience in a growing teaching hospital. Our culture is diverse friendly and open to ideas.
